Description

Postcard depicting a painting of a sailfish and boats. The description on the verso reads, ‘Sailfish - Gulf Stream, Key West, Florida. A hooked sailfish leaps out of the inky blue waters of the Gulf Stream in the Florida Keys. The painting hangs in the Key West Chamber of Commerce. It was done by the well known painter Anton Otto Fischer who illustated many stories for the Saturday Evening Post. His wife was the daughter of Admiral Sigsbee, the Captain of the battleship MAINE. They lived in Key West for many years. Many of his paintings were made from memory of his years at sea.'
